Output 23da93d844ba98e1afc5bbfe16eaaeeadc932ea0da956e9c6b18b6e134919d23:3

value
70481060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5714f4d4dcb6041559b05ad72d031e7bee3582a6 OP_EQUAL
address
MFqc8CC4H2YSw2443JZNuPuF6QD6AA4Qho
transaction
23da93d844ba98e1afc5bbfe16eaaeeadc932ea0da956e9c6b18b6e134919d23
spent
true